Creating A Strawberry Base
The first special element of these delicious Strawberry Chocolate Chunk Streusel Muffins is their light strawberry base. While many muffin recipes use buttermilk, sour cream or plain yogurt to help enhance both the flavor and fluffiness of the muffin base, these muffins use strawberry Kefir or strawberry Greek yogurt mixed with a bit of water to create a subtly strawberry flavored muffin base. The strawberry Kefir is preferred here to provide a similar light texture and acidity to buttermilk, however if you cannot find strawberry Kefir, thinning strawberry Greek yogurt with a bit of water can create a similar effect. This subtle change from a traditional dairy product makes for a lovely strawberry flavor throughout the muffin that then is further enhanced by the addition of chopped strawberries. By the inclusion of both chopped strawberries and strawberry Kefir / yogurt, these muffins are both wonderfully moist and fabulously flavorful.
A Highlight Of Chocolate
If a strawberry muffin isn’t enough, why not add a highlight of chocolate! Chocolate dipped strawberries are such a classic Valentine’s Day staple that adding a touch of chocolate to the strawberry base of these Strawberry Chocolate Chunk Streusel Muffins felt like the perfect touch. I would recommend including a 60% to 70% dark chocolate to provide a bit of contrast to the sweet strawberries without being too stark. If opting for a darker chocolate than a low 70 or 72%, try to stick with a chocolate that has a fruity base instead of one that leans earthy or nutty to ensure the muffin has a cohesive flavor.

Recipe
![Strawberry Chocolate Chip Streusel Muffins](https://i0.wp.com/porchandpeony.com/wp-content/uploads/2025/01/Strawberry-Chocolate-Chip-Streusel-Muffins-1.jpg?fit=188%2C250&ssl=1)
Strawberry Chocolate Chunk Streusel Muffins
Ingredients
Muffins
- 1/2 cup Butter, melted
- 3/4 cup Strawberry Kefir OR 1/2 cup strawberry Greek yogurt thinned with 1/4 cup water
- 2 Eggs
- 3/4 cup Sugar
- 2 tsp Vanilla extract
- 2 cups + 1 tbsp All purpose flour
- 1 tbsp Baking powder
- 3/4 tsp Salt
- 1/2 cup Strawberries, diced
- 100 grams Dark chocolate, chopped 60% – 70% dark is recommended
Streusel Topping
- 2 tbsp Butter, melted
- 4 tbsp All purpose flour
- 1 tbsp Sugar
Instructions
- Preheat the oven to 425℉ or 220℃. Line a muffin tin with muffin cups before setting aside.
- In a large bowl, mix together the melted butter, strawberry Kefir (or thinned Greek yogurt), sugar, eggs and vanilla extract.
- Next, fold in 2 cups of the all purpose flour, baking powder and salt until just combined. Be sure not to overmix.
- Slowly fold in the chopped chocolate (or chocolate chips), chopped strawberries and remaining 1 tablespoon of all purpose flour.
- Scoop the batter into the prepared muffin cups, filling just shy of the top of each cup.
- In a small bowl, combine the melted butter, flour and sugar for the streusel topping until it comes together in small clumps. Sprinkle the top of each muffin cup with a bit of this topping.
- Bake for 5 to 7 minutes at 425℉, then, without opening the oven door, reduce the heat to 350℉ (or 180℃) and bake for another 15 minutes or until a toothpick inserted into the center of the muffin comes out clean or with only a couple of crumbs.
- Remove from the oven and allow to cool for 10 minutes before transferring to a rack to fully cool or a plate to serve. Muffins can be stored at room temperature for up to 3 days (if they last that long!). Enjoy!
